Iniciador de DOOM (DSDA-DOOM, Doom Retro ou Woof!)
Publicado por Xerxes (última atualização em 05/09/2024)
[ Hits: 2.750 ]
Homepage: -
Simples script que estou usando atualmente para iniciar minhas partidas de DOOM. Já revisitei o Ultimate DOOM (todos os mapas, 100% em UV) e agora estou revisitando o DOOM 2. Assim que iniciar novos mapas, incluirei as opções no script. Como poderá notar, não é um script pretensioso, sendo voltado para meu uso pessoal.
#!/bin/bash # Defina o caminho para o executável do Doom Retro e os arquivos WAD DOOM_EXEC="/home/xerxes/doom/Woof-14.5.0-Linux.appimage" # Pergunta ao usuário qual port deseja usar echo "Escolha o port:" echo "1) Doom Retro" echo "2) DSDA-Doom" echo "3) Woof" read -p "Digite o número correspondente ao port desejado: " PORT_CHOICE # Define o executável com base na escolha do port case $PORT_CHOICE in 1) DOOM_EXEC="doomretro" ;; 2) DOOM_EXEC="dsda-doom" ;; 3) DOOM_EXEC="/home/xerxes/doom/Woof-14.5.0-Linux.appimage" ;; *) echo "Escolha inválida. Usando Woof como padrão." DOOM_EXEC="/home/xerxes/doom/Woof-14.5.0-Linux.appimage" ;; esac # Pergunta ao usuário se deseja jogar Ultimate DOOM ou DOOM 2 echo "Qual jogo você deseja jogar?" echo "1) Ultimate DOOM" echo "2) DOOM 2" read -p "Digite o número correspondente ao jogo desejado: " GAME_CHOICE # Define o caminho para o IWAD e os mods com base na escolha do jogo case $GAME_CHOICE in 1) IWAD_PATH=~/doom/iwads/DOOM.WAD MODS=( ~/doom/modsv/D1SPFX20.WAD ~/doom/modsv/doom_colored_blood.deh ~/doom/modsv/doom_uwide_v2.wad ~/doom/modsv/dsitemup.wad ~/doom/modsv/pk_doom_sfx_20120224.wad ~/doom/modsv/DoomMetalVol6.wad ~/doom/modsv/flavorbigdsda2.wad ~/doom/modsv/EXTRAsmooth.wad ) ;; 2) IWAD_PATH=~/doom/iwads/DOOM2.WAD MODS=( ~/doom/modsv/D2SPFX20.WAD ~/doom/modsv/doom_colored_blood.deh ~/doom/modsv/doom_uwide_v2.wad ~/doom/modsv/dsitemup.wad ~/doom/modsv/pk_doom_sfx_20120224.wad ~/doom/modsv/DoomMetalVol6.wad ~/doom/modsv/flavorbigdsda2.wad ~/doom/modsv/EXTRAsmooth.wad ) ;; *) echo "Escolha inválida. Usando DOOM 2 como padrão." IWAD_PATH=~/doom/iwads/DOOM2.WAD MODS=( ~/doom/modsv/D2SPFX20.WAD ~/doom/modsv/doom_colored_blood.deh ~/doom/modsv/doom_uwide_v2.wad ~/doom/modsv/dsitemup.wad ~/doom/modsv/pk_doom_sfx_20120224.wad ~/doom/modsv/DoomMetalVol6.wad ~/doom/modsv/flavorbigdsda2.wad ~/doom/modsv/EXTRAsmooth.wad ) ;; esac # Exibe as opções selecionadas echo "Port selecionado: $DOOM_EXEC" echo "IWAD selecionado: $IWAD_PATH" echo "Mods aplicados: ${MODS[@]}" # Executa o Doom com as opções selecionadas $DOOM_EXEC -iwad "$IWAD_PATH" -file "${MODS[@]}"
Instalar impressora no CUPS a partir de um arquivo PPD
CoDe_X - Compactador/Descompactador de arquivos e diretórios usando Xdialog
Alterar o endereço MAC de uma interface de rede
Passkeys: A Evolução da Autenticação Digital
Instalação de distro Linux em computadores, netbooks, etc, em rede com o Clonezilla
Título: Descobrindo o IP externo da VPN no Linux
Armazenando a senha de sua carteira Bitcoin de forma segura no Linux
Enviar mensagem ao usuário trabalhando com as opções do php.ini
Instalando Brave Browser no Linux Mint 22
vídeo pra quem quer saber como funciona Proteção de Memória:
Encontre seus arquivos facilmente com o Drill
Mouse Logitech MX Ergo Advanced Wireless Trackball no Linux
Compartilhamento de Rede com samba em modo Público/Anônimo de forma simples, rápido e fácil
Programa duplicado no "Abrir com" e na barra de pesquisa do ... (1)
VMs e Interfaces de Rede desapareceram (13)
Como abrir o pycharm no linux [RESOLVIDO] (4)